2003/11/02 · SPM stands for shock pulse monitoring. The term “shock pulse” describes what is produced when a ridge or asperity from one surface contacts a ridge or asperity of another surface when the lubricant film, designed to separate those surfaces, is lost. The pulse is a high-frequency signal that is collected with a sensor tuned to measure noise

Shock pulse amplitude is due to three basic factors: Rolling velocity (bearing size and rpm) Oil film thickness (separation between the metal surfaces in the rolling interface). The oil film depends on lubricant supply and also on alignment and pre-load. The mechanical state of the bearing surfaces (roughness, stress, damage, loose metal particle).

Step 1 - Amplification. Shock Pulse signals are relatively small in amplitude and do not travel great distances. To amplify the small Shock Pulse signal the piezo electric crystal stacks, which are the actual element in an. accelerometer that generates signals, are constructed in such a fashion that they are excited by the 36 kilohertz.
